What is the normal timeline for an accident case?
The timeline can vary substantially depending upon case intricacy, the cooperation of insurance companies, and whether the case goes to trial. Some cases can settle in months, while others might take years.
Just how much does it cost to work with an Accident Injury Attorney attorney?
A lot of Accident Injury Legal Advice lawyers run on a contingency cost basis, implying they only earn money if you win. Costs usually vary from 25% to 40% of the settlement.
What if my accident was partly my fault?
In many states, you can still recover damages even if you were partially at fault. Nevertheless, your compensation might be decreased based on your percentage of fault.
Can I handle my case without an attorney?
While it is possible to represent yourself, it is highly prevented. The legal system is complicated, and having an attorney can significantly improve your chances of a beneficial result.
What should I do instantly after an accident?
Look for medical attention, gather evidence (photos, witness information), and get in touch with an attorney as quickly as possible to discuss your case.
